I am working on this generic virtio-serial interface for appliances. To start 
with I experimented on existing Wangpan's added feature on hw_qemu_guest agent. 
I am preparing to propose a blueprint to modify it for generic use and open to 
collaborate.

I could bring up VM with generic source path(say /tmp/appliance_port) and 
target name(appliance_port). But I see qemu listening on the unix socket in 
host as soon as I start the VM. If we want to have our server program on host 
listening, that should not happen. How do I overcome that?

> Virtio-Serial interface support for Nova - Libvirt is not available now. Some 
> VMs who wants to access the Host may need like running qemu-guest-agent or 
> any proprietary software want to use this mode of communication with Host.
>
> Qemu-GA uses virtio-serial communication.
>
> We want to propose a blue-print on this for IceHouse Release.
